科技前沿:混合式APP开发浪潮,引领未来移动应用新趋势
在移动互联网飞速发展的今天,手机APP已成为人们生活中不可或缺的一部分。无论是社交娱乐、工作学习还是生活服务,各类APP层出不穷,满足着人们多样化的需求。而在APP开发领域,混合式APP开发正逐渐成为一种备受瞩目的趋势,它融合了原生应用和网页应用的优势,为开发者和用户带来了前所未有的体验。
据权威机构发布的最新行业数据显示,近年来混合式APP的市场规模呈现出爆发式增长。预计在未来几年内,其市场占有率将进一步提升,成为APP开发领域的主流选择之一。这一数据的背后,是混合式APP开发技术不断成熟以及市场需求的持续推动。
开发app用什么语言(开发app用什么语言最好)
在APP开发的世界里,编程语言就像是构建大厦的基石,不同的语言有着各自的特点和优势,适用于不同类型的APP开发需求。对于想要涉足APP开发的开发者来说,选择一门合适的编程语言至关重要。
不得不提的是Java。Java作为一种成熟且广泛应用的编程语言,具有强大的跨平台性和丰富的类库。在Android开发领域,Java占据着主导地位。据统计,目前市场上超过80%的Android应用都是使用Java开发的。它的语法严谨,逻辑清晰,拥有庞大的开发者社区,这意味着开发者在遇到问题时可以很容易地找到解决方案和参考资料。Java的性能优化技术也非常成熟,能够开发出高效稳定的APP。

Python也是近年来备受青睐的APP开发语言之一。Python以其简洁易懂的语法和丰富的第三方库而闻名。它特别适合快速原型开发和数据处理相关的APP。一些数据分析、人工智能领域的APP,使用Python可以大大提高开发效率。有数据显示,使用Python进行开发可以将开发周期缩短30% - 50%。Python还有着良好的可读性,使得代码维护更加方便。
JavaScript同样在APP开发中发挥着重要作用。特别是在前端开发方面,JavaScript几乎是不可或缺的。随着React Native等跨平台框架的兴起,JavaScript在混合式APP开发中的应用越来越广泛。它可以让用户使用一套代码同时构建iOS和Android应用,大大提高了开发效率。JavaScript的学习曲线相对较平缓,对于初学者来说比较友好。
除了上述几种语言外,Swift、Kotlin等语言也在各自的领域有着独特的优势。Swift是苹果公司为iOS开发推出的编程语言,与iOS系统深度集成,性能优异;Kotlin则是Google官方推荐的Android开发语言,与Java兼容,语法更加简洁。

要说哪种语言是最好的,并没有一个绝对的答案。选择开发APP的语言需要根据具体的项目需求、开发团队的技术栈以及目标平台等多方面因素来综合考虑。

如何开发混合式app?
开发混合式APP是一个复杂而又充满挑战的过程,需要开发者掌握多种技术和工具,同时还要注重用户体验和性能优化。
在开发之前,首先要明确APP的功能和需求。这是整个开发过程的基础,只有清楚地知道用户需要什么,才能开发出符合市场需求的APP。一款社交类的混合式APP,可能需要具备用户注册登录、好友添加、动态发布、消息推送等功能。开发者需要与产品经理、设计师等密切合作,对功能进行详细的分析和规划。
选择合适的开发框架是关键。目前市面上有许多成熟的混合式APP开发框架可供选择,如React Native、Flutter、Ionic等。据相关数据统计,React Native是目前最受欢迎的混合式APP开发框架之一,它被广泛应用于各种类型的APP开发中。这些框架提供了丰富的组件和工具,可以帮助开发者快速搭建APP的界面和功能。以React Native为例,它使用JavaScript和React编写,开发者可以利用熟悉的Web开发技术来构建跨平台的移动应用。
界面设计也是开发过程中不可忽视的一环。一个好的界面设计可以吸引用户的注意力,提高用户的使用体验。在设计界面时,要遵循简洁、美观、易用的原则。可以使用专业的设计工具,如Sketch、Adobe D等,来创建高质量的界面设计稿。要考虑到不同屏幕尺寸和分辨率的适配问题,确保APP在各种设备上都能正常显示。
数据存储和管理也是混合式APP开发的重要。根据APP的功能需求,可以选择不同的数据存储方式,如本地存储、云端存储等。对于一些需要频繁访问的数据,可以采用本地存储的方式,以提高访问速度;而对于一些大量的数据,则可以选择云端存储,以确保数据的安全性和可靠性。
测试和调试是保证APP质量的重要环节。在开发过程中,要不断地进行测试和调试,及时发现和解决问题。可以进行单元测试、集成测试、兼容性测试等多种测试,以确保APP在不同的环境和设备上都能正常运行。根据最新的行业报告,经过充分测试和调试的APP,其用户满意度可以提高20% - 30%。
创业版企业上市条件解析
本文详细解析了创业版企业上市所需的基本条件,包括财务标准、业务模式、市场审核等方面的内容,为企业成功上市提供了全面的指南。
免费AI机器人软件的探索之旅
本文介绍了市场上几款优秀的免费AI机器人软件,包括OpenAI的GPT系列模型、InVision的A/B Testing工具以及Google Cloud提供的免费AI服务。还推荐了一些适合初学者的开源AI项目和机器学习框架,帮助用户在不花费一分钱的情况下,充分利用AI的强大功能。
未来科技:AI与人类共生的新篇章
本文探讨了人工智能(AI)与人类共生的未来趋势,分析了技术进步带来的机遇与挑战,并提出了相应的对策建议。文章强调了在享受AI便利的同时,必须关注其对就业市场的影响以及伦理道德问题的重要性。
探索未来科技:人工智能如何重塑我们的世界
本文探讨了人工智能如何改变我们的日常生活、工作方式以及医疗领域等多个方面。通过分析AI技术的优势与挑战,提出了应对策略和建议。




